Microwave Energy Transmission

WHY THIS MATTERS IN BRIEF China and other countries believe that space based solar power stations could solve a lot…

WHY THIS MATTERS IN BRIEF There are many advantages to generating solar power in space and beaming it back to…

WHY THIS MATTERS IN BRIEF Beaming electricity means you don’t need energy infrastructure and has lots of benefits, this was…